Oscillators are widely used in a variety of applications such as frequency synthesis, signal processing, communications, control systems, and automotive electronics applications. A good example is the SG-310SCN 16.3840MJ6, which has been designed for generating precise frequencies and timing signals. In this article, the application fields and working principles of SG-310SCN 16.3840MJ6 oscillators will be discussed.
Application Field
SG-310SCN 16.3840MJ6 oscillators are used in Frequency Synthesis applications, such as clock and data recovery, clock synthesis, and spread spectrum applications. It is also used in System Timing applications such as low-jitter clock generation, wireless communication, and system clock generation. In addition, the oscillator is used in Automotive Applications, particularly for high-temperature safety-critical clock requirements. The features of SG-310SCN 16.3840MJ6 oscillators such as low power consumption, quiet mode operation, spread spectrum support, low noise, and good jitter performance make them suitable for these applications.
Working Principles
SG-310SCN 16.3840MJ6 oscillators generate high-frequency signals through its crystal oscillator circuit. The crystal will vibrate at its resonant frequency when a constant voltage is applied across it. This signal is then amplified and buffered to produce a stable signal at the correct frequency. The oscillator features spread spectrum support, which allows the oscillator to generate frequencies that are spread across a certain frequency spectrum. This can help reduce overall system noise and improve signal quality. The oscillator also features low noise operation, which reduces unwanted spurious signals from interfering with the output.
In addition, the oscillator features good jitter performance, which enables it to preserve low-noise operation even at high speed operation. This helps to reduce jitter in system clocks, ensuring that timing signals stay precise and stable. The oscillator also features low power consumption, which makes it suitable for applications that require power efficiency. The oscillator is also designed to operate in quiet mode, which reduces EMI noise and ensures compliance with low-emission standards.
The SG-310SCN 16.3840MJ6 oscillator is a versatile and reliable component for a wide range of frequency synthesis, system timing and automotive applications. It features several features such as spread spectrum operation, low noise operation, good jitter performance, low power consumption, and quiet mode operation, making it suitable for a variety of system clock and signal generation applications.
